The factors of 16 are 1, 2, 4, 8, and 16.
<span>The factors of 24 are 1, 2, 3, 4, 6, 8, 12, and 24. </span>
<span>The factors of 40 are 1, 2, 4, 5, 8, 10, 20, and 40. </span>
<span>So the greatest common factor of 16, 24, and 40 is 8.
